How they compare
Western Sahara currently reports 507.58 kt against -1,267 kt in Democratic Republic of the Congo, a difference of 1,775 kt.
The two have swapped places 1 time across 34 shared years of data; in 1990 it was Democratic Republic of the Congo ahead.
Democratic Republic of the Congo ranks 12th and Western Sahara ranks 15th of 21 countries.
Across the 4 decades both report, Democratic Republic of the Congo averaged higher in 2 and Western Sahara in 2.
Head to head by decade
| Decade | Democratic Republic of the Congo | Western Sahara |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 9.25 kt | -777.42 kt | 786.67 kt | Democratic Republic of the Congo |
| 2000s | -6.21 kt | -387.84 kt | 381.63 kt | Democratic Republic of the Congo |
| 2010s | -1,258 kt | -326.05 kt | 931.73 kt | Western Sahara |
| 2020s | -1,419 kt | 294.69 kt | 1,714 kt | Western Sahara |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
